A WOMAN has been raped by two men in broad daylight.

The horror took place in Alcott Woods, off Moorend Avenue in Chelmsley Wood, in Solihull, at about 8am on Monday.

A West Midlands Police spokesperson said: “We’re investigating after a woman was raped by two men in Chelmsley Wood.

“It happened at Alcott Woods in Chelmsley Wood at around 8am yesterday.

“We are supporting the woman, and officers have been in the area carrying searches and other enquiries.

“The investigation is at a very early stage and anyone with information has been asked to get in touch via Live Chat or 101 quoting log 1844 of 10 February.

“We have extra officers in the area to offer reassurance.

“Alternatively, information can be given via Crimestoppers anonymously on 0800 555 111.”
